When the Juniper Networks routing platform supports the use of the Diameter protocol to provide extended AAA functionality, the SRC software can dynamically manage services on these devices. The SRC software uses the Diameter protocol for communications between the local SRC peer on a Juniper Networks routing platform, such as the Juniper Networks MX Series Ethernet Services Router, and the SAE. The local SRC peer is known as JSRC and is part of the AAA application.

The SRC software enables the SAE to activate and deactivate subscriber services and log out subscribers. The SAE can control only those resources that have been provisioned through the SAE. Therefore, the SAE receives information about only those subscribers for whom JSRC has requested provisioning from the SAE. Similarly, the SAE can control only the subscriber services that it has activated.
